What are the responsibilities and job description for the Travel Nurse - Registered Nurse - Pediatric Operating Room position at The VIOS Clinic?
Role: Pediatric Operating Room Registered Nurse for a travel assignment in Chicago, IL.
Responsibilities: Provide specialized nursing care in a Level I Pediatric Trauma & Teaching Facility, ensuring patient safety and quality care in the operating room. Manage perioperative procedures, assist surgical teams, and maintain sterile environments. Support clinical teams and adhere to best practices and safety protocols.
Qualifications & Skills: Valid RN license, BLS certification, and experience in pediatric perioperative nursing. Strong clinical skills, attention to detail, and ability to work in fast-paced environments. Excellent communication and teamwork abilities.
Key Duties: Deliver patient-centered care, coordinate with surgical teams, ensure compliance with safety standards, and support the facility’s trauma and teaching missions. Maintain documentation and follow protocols to optimize patient outcomes.
